Michael Cohen was confronted by some of Donald Trump’s supporters shortly before he took the stand to testify in the criminal hush-money trial against the ex-president.

May 14, 2024, published at 9:00 AM ET

Michael Cohen was confronted with some of Donald Trump‘s supporters shortly before he took the stand this week to testify in the criminal hush-money trial of the ex-president, RadarOnline.com has learned.

The surprising confrontation took place last weekend at the swanky members’ club Casa Cipriani in Manhattan, as Cohen prepared to take the witness stand and to give evidence Monday before the prosecutor.

Trump’s former lawyer and fixer testified that he distributed the $130,000 for Daniels at the then presidential candidate’s direction and was promised repayment.

“I wanted to make sure that again he approved of what I did because I need approval from him for all of this,” Cohen said told the Public Prosecution Service on Monday.
